Dispute Resolution Process

Disputes are resolved with the claimant by negotiation involving the business, accounts payable and NBCU Business lead counsel, and if required litigation counsel will be contacted.

Does this business offer supply chain finance?

This is where a supplier who has submitted an invoice can be paid by a third-party finance provider earlier than the agreed payment date. The business would then pay the finance provider the invoiced sum.
